The virtual schools market size is estimated to increase by USD 4.57 billion and grow at a CAGR of 15.2% between 2023 and 2028. The virtual schools market is experiencing robust growth, driven by a surge in demand and enrollment. This increased interest is further accelerated by strategic partnerships and collaborations among key industry players, which enhance the accessibility and quality of virtual education. These alliances often bring together resources and expertise, fostering innovative solutions and expanding the reach of virtual schools. Additionally, significant investments in improving educational quality are playing a crucial role in market expansion. These investments focus on enhancing technological infrastructure, developing comprehensive curricula, and supporting educators, all of which contribute to a more effective and engaging learning experience. The combined impact of rising enrollment, collaborative efforts, and financial commitment to educational excellence creates a dynamic environment for the growth of virtual schools, meeting the evolving needs of students and educators in a digital age.

Virtual schools have been experiencing significant growth in North America. This growth has been driven by various factors, including advancements in technology, and changing educational needs and preferences. In terms of scheduling and pace of study, virtual education offers flexibility. Virtual schools also often offer personal learning experiences, which adapt to each student's different learning styles and enable self-paced training.

North America is estimated to contribute 48% to the growth of the global market during the forecast period. Technavio’s analysts have elaborately explained the regional trends and drivers that shape the market during the forecast period. Virtual schools often offer individualized support systems such as virtual tutoring, academic counseling, and additional resources to address the unique needs of each student. The popularity and growth of virtual schools in North America have resulted in the development of dedicated virtual school programs, both within traditional public school systems and through online charter schools or independent virtual school providers. Such factors will increase the market growth in this region during the forecast period.

Apps and wearables for virtual education are key trends in the market. In view of their ability to improve the learning experience and provide other functions, apps, and wearables are becoming increasingly popular in Virtual Schools. Apps and wearables offer interactive features that make learning engaging and immersive. They provide interactive quizzes, games, simulations, and multimedia content that promote active learning and increase student engagement.
Thus, such technologies support personalized learning experiences by adapting to individual student needs. With each student's learning style, pace, and preferences, mobile apps, and wearables may develop personalized recommendations, content adapted to suit their individual needs, and tailored feedback. The growing adoption of wearables will boost the growth of the global market during the forecast period.
The high cost associated with virtual schools is a major challenge in the market. In order to operate the virtual school, the investment in necessary technology infrastructure which includes hardware, software, and educational management systems as well as internet connectivity. This includes providing students with devices such as computers or tablets and ensuring reliable Internet access for both students and teacher.
However, virtual schools often utilize learning management systems (LMS) or educational software to manage student enrollment, deliver content, track progress, and facilitate communication. The total expenditure may be increased by the cost of licensing or developing and maintaining these systems. Therefore, the high development costs associated with virtual e-learning courses are likely to slow down the growth of the market in focus during the forecast period.
